Adani Green Energy Ltd’s arm Adani Renewable Energy Holding Twelve Ltd (AREH12L) has received a Letter of Award from Uttar Pradesh Power Corp. Ltd (UPPCL) for supply of 400 MW solar power at a tariff of INR 2.57/kWh for a period of 25 years. It will develop grid-connected PV projects in Rajasthan to supply power to UPPCL.
The announcement follows commissioning of 396.7 MW of power projects (287.5 MW solar and 109.2 MW wind) at Khavda, Gujarat, by Adani Green Energy Ltd through its various wholly-owned step-down subsidiaries.
With commissioning of this plant, Adani Green Energy Ltd ’s total operational renewable generation capacity has increased to 13,487.8 MW.
